A common issue that arises is … NettetThe statutory FBT method is based on how much the vehicle costs rather than how much it is being used privately. It uses a flat rate of 20% of the car’s base value, taking into account the number of days per year the vehicle is available for private use. Put simply, the base value is the car’s purchase price, less stamp duty and any ...

This new rule only applies to motor vehicles acquired or first used for business on or after 1 … NettetKeeping records of every exempt day can be time consuming. Instead, you can keep a full record of exemptions over a 3 month test period and then use these results for the next 3 years. After 3 years you’ll need to run a new test period.
